After a lot of experimenting, I finally made my first complete card which was a masculine card using the Wild Cats suite. Instead of stamping the images using the Wild Cats Stamp Set, I used an image I had die-cut previously from a design in the In The Wild Designer Series Paper (DSP). As much as I still love the Sailing Home Stamp Set, it’s great to have another great option for masculine cards!
For the masculine card I decided to dry emboss the top Basic White CS layer using the Animal Print Embossing Folder. After popping the tiger up on Dimensionals, I was going to add some die-cut grasses and plants around him to make him look as if he was sitting in the jungle. I decided against this idea and just added the HAPPY BIRTHDAY sentiment which I also popped up on Dimensionals.
On the Sweet as a Peach card I used the same DSP on the front of the card and inside on the back panel and on the tiger card I used two different designs. I think the idea worked well for both cards. Inside the tiger card I added a die-cut plant on the plain white panel as a small decoration but I always find it difficult finding something to decorate in the peach cards with!

Measurements
NOTE: NA is North America i.e. letter-size cardstock users
Stitched Rectangles Die no 5 is approx 2 5/8” x a tad short of 4” (6.6cm x 10.1cm)
Stitched Rectangles Die no 6 is approx 3” x a tad short of 4 3/8” (7.6cm x 11.1cm)
Calypso Coral Cardstock – 2 pieces 8¼” x 5¾” (21cm x 14.6cm) NA 8½” x 5½”
Score one piece at 4 1/8” (10.5cm) NA 4¼” and the second piece at 2 1/16”, 4 1/8” (5.25cm, 10.5cm) NA 2 1/8”, 4¼”; turn cardstock 180°, score at 2 1/16” (5.25cm) NA 2 1/8”
Basic White Cardstock – 2 pieces 1 7/8” x 5½” (4.8cm x 14cm) NA 1 7/8” x 5¼”
You’re a Peach Designer Series Paper – 1¾” x 5 3/8” (4.5cm x 13.7cm) NA 1¾” x 5 1/8”
Basic White Cardstock – front frame 3 7/8” x 5½” (9.9cm x 14cm) NA 4” x 5¼”
You’re a Peach Designer Series Paper – 3¾” x 5 3/8” (9.6cm x 13.7cm) NA 3 7/8” x 5 1/8”
Calypso Coral Cardstock – layer for swing image 2½” x 3 7/8” (6.3cm x 9.9cm) NA 2½” x 3 7/8”
Basic White Cardstock – swing top layer – 2 3/8” x 3¾” (6cm x 9.6cm) NA 2 3/8” x 3¾”
Basic White Cardstock – scrap for sentiment
